El día de la boda is a conventional romantic comedy that reflects the social and gender hierarchies of 1960s Mexico. While the film offers a culturally authentic experience, it does not challenge established power dynamics. The production stands out for its ethnic authenticity, featuring a cast that accurately represents its Mexican origins. However, this cultural accuracy is paired with traditional courtship clichés and storytelling that assumes everyone is straight or cisgender. Overall, the film serves as a baseline for traditional mid-century media, prioritizing romantic resolution and social reintegration over diverse representation or the subversion of domestic norms.
